So,

I've never had this problem before at the Osceola Campus of Valencia College. But, this semester I'm over at the West Campus. As most of you know I'm disabled and with my heart problem walking long distances with text books is hard on me. I have a state issued permanent disabled license plate on Flick.

I went in to security to get my parking permit and was told I was not allowed to park in handicapped that I had to park in MC parking which is a good distance from my class. After, a couple of hours the consented to let me park next to one building. But, if I needed to go to the library, cafeteria, or main office I would not be allowed to park in disabled parking. Also, if more disabled cars started parking in that area I would lose that privilege as well because cars had the priority. When I asked how could that even be fair I was told if I wanted to park in handicapped I should drive my car in!

I'm not sure what my recourse is! Any help would be appreciated.
mary

Whoa, Mary!  The Americans With Disabilities Act is federal law.  They have to accomodate you in a reasonable fashion.  You deserve a disabled parking spot no matter what you drive, as long as space isn't a concern, which it clearly isn't.  That would be discrimination.  You have a strong case, but I hope you haven't made it public yet, i.e, call the media.  That is your last resort, not the first.  Hope I'm not too late.

Have your lawyer send a letter to the school and don't be surprised if they let you park your bike in the Dean's office.  They DON'T want to be embarrassed.  Privacy works in your favor in the early stages to get the right thing done before it turns into a circus.
